👀 SPOILER-FREE SUMMARY

Dororo shifts into a deeply contemplative register with this episode, pulling back from the relentless demon-slaying to sit with harder questions about identity, purpose, and moral compromise. The pacing is deliberate and introspective, giving Hyakkimaru and Jukai the space to reckon with the weight of their choices and the cost of the journey so far. Expect a quieter intensity here — the kind of episode that trades sword clashes for emotional confrontation. Themes of what it means to be human, who gets to define that, and whether reclaiming what was stolen justifies the destruction left behind sit at the center. This is a character-driven turning point, not an action showcase. If the series' philosophical undercurrent is what hooked you, this episode rewards that investment fully.

📍 ARC CONTEXT

Positioned at the two-thirds mark of the 24-episode run, Episode 17 follows Hyakkimaru's direct confrontation with his past in Episode 16 and uses that momentum to force a reckoning with the moral cost of his quest. This is a critical inflection point for character development, establishing the emotional and philosophical stakes that will drive the final act. The groundwork laid here — particularly around Hyakkimaru and Jukai's dynamic — directly sets up the escalating tensions and irreversible decisions that define the series' closing stretch.
